What is Outdoor WiFi and How Does it Work?

Traditional WiFi is typically limited to indoor coverage, often obstructed by WiFi-blocking materials. Outdoor WiFi is a wireless internet solution designed to extend an organization's existing internet network outside using outdoor WiFi access points and outdoor WiFi extenders. They broadcast WiFi signals over a wide outdoor area, keeping cell phones, tablets, laptops, and IoT equipment within range online as if they were indoors. Equipment is built tough, ensuring reliable performance even during inclement weather.

6 Benefits of Outdoor WiFi

1. Covers More Area

You might be wondering, “How far can WiFi reach outdoors?” With the right equipment, outdoor Wi-Fi can cover large areas, eliminating those frustrating dead spots. Whether it’s providing seamless connectivity for a café’s patio, extending coverage around a hotel’s pool, or ensuring strong signals for an outdoor event, a robust setup makes it possible. Employees, customers, and unmanned IoT devices can stay effortlessly connected no matter where they are.

2. Connects All Your Gadgets

It’s not just personal devices like phones and laptops that rely on a strong WiFi connection. So do security cameras, remote sensors, EV chargers, PoS systems, and ATMs, which are all becoming more prevalent in business spaces. With a robust outdoor WiFi network, all devices throughout the entire property can transfer data more smoothly with little to no connectivity issues, enhancing operational efficiency and the bottom line.

3. Enhances Security

Outdoor Wi-Fi enhances the reliability of security technology used to monitor your property. Businesses can easily install security cameras and other surveillance equipment over larger areas without worrying about connection loss, ensuring comprehensive coverage. Stable WiFi enables real-time monitoring and quicker response efforts to potential threats, enhancing overall safety and security.

4. Futureproofs Businesses

Technology is constantly evolving, changing the way businesses operate. Whether for smart city initiatives or enhanced security, outdoor WiFi makes it easier for businesses to adopt new technology without having to deploy new infrastructure. As connectivity needs increase and WiFi standards (e.g. WiFi 5, WiFi 6, WiFi 7) improve, it's easy to scale and upgrade an outdoor WiFi system, ensuring businesses remain adaptable and future-ready.

Where Outdoor WiFi is Critical

1. Schools

outdoor wifi at school


Schools, colleges, and universities are large spaces where students often need internet access beyond the classroom walls. With outdoor Wi-Fi, they can study or even attend outdoor classes without any connectivity issues. For higher education institutions, where students frequently work and collaborate in outdoor areas like courtyards and quads, reliable WiFi is essential.

Additionally, for students who may not have internet access at home, outdoor Wi-Fi provided by their school offers a valuable opportunity to complete assignments and continue their education outside of regular class hours. Teachers can also take advantage of these outdoor spaces for lessons, making learning more engaging and interactive. It’s an effective way to ensure that education isn’t limited to just the indoors.

2. Offices

Some offices offer outdoor spaces where employees can work. However, the WiFi in those areas isn’t always reliable. Outdoor Wi-Fi allows employees to work from any location without worrying about dropped connections. This enhances productivity and collaboration in open-air environments. Even outdoor smart devices and clients will remain reliability-connected.

3. Parks

People love visiting parks, but they also like staying connected. WiFi in parks lets visitors check maps, post photos, or just browse the web while enjoying nature. It’s also helpful for park management, allowing them to offer services like event information or even WiFi-based games and activities.
